Xavi: 'Jack Wilshere can be the difference'

Former Barcelona midfielder Xavi has claimed that Jack Wilshere can go on to "make the difference" for Arsenal and England. The 23-year-old midfielder is currently out of action until December after suffering a hairline fracture to his leg before the season began, which is the latest in a number of injury setbacks for the player. Xavi has admitted that he has been impressed with Wilshere whenever the pair have crossed paths. "He played a fantastic game against us [in 2011]. Let's not forget he was just 20 or 21 years old.
